Funding Round Developments, Strategic Acquisitions, and AI Oversight at Replit
In a significant series of developments for Replit, three major announcements this December reflect both the company’s ambitious growth strategy and its commitment to innovation within the tech ecosystem. First, discussions regarding a new funding round signal a potential valuation surge for Replit. Reports indicate that the company is in negotiation with various investors for a funding round that may elevate its worth to an impressive $3 billion. This potential increase, tripling its current valuation, underlines the growing interest in coding platforms that are revolutionizing the way developers engage with programming and software development.
In tandem with these funding discussions, Replit has made headlines by acquiring OpenInt, its first strategic acquisition since the company’s founding. This move is poised to bolster Replit’s artificial intelligence capabilities, a critical area as AI continues to intersect with coding and software development. By integrating OpenInt’s advanced AI technologies, Replit aims to enhance user experiences and streamline solutions for its growing community of developers and learners. This acquisition not only positions Replit as a leader in the coding landscape but also reflects its strategy to harness cutting-edge technology to meet the evolving needs of its users.
Amid these developments, Replit faced a challenging situation when one of its AI coding assistants inadvertently deleted a live database. The incident prompted a public response from Replit’s CEO, who acknowledged the seriousness of the issue and outlined the company’s commitment to developing robust safeguards against such occurrences. This response highlights Replit’s proactive stance on transparency and accountability within the rapidly advancing field of AI, ensuring that user trust remains a cornerstone of their growth strategy.
